Katherina Kober Stelzer Schneider was born in 1765 in Untergrombach, Karlsruhe, Baden-Wuerttemberg, Germany, the child of Franz Stelzer And Barbara Soher. Katherina Kober Stelzer Schneider married Johann Jacob Schneider, and had children including Catherina Josepha Schneider, Johann George Schneider, Johann Jacob Schneider, Johann Michael Schneider, Johannes Martin Schneider, Maria Catherine Herrig Schneider Michels, Sebastian Schneider, Valentin Schneider. Katherina Kober Stelzer Schneider passed away in 1851 in Untergrombach, Karlsruhe, Baden-Wuerttemberg, Germany.
